Police say a South Carolina man fatally shot another man in the head, stole his car and then drove to Florida for spring break.
Daytona Beach police arrested 24-year-old Donald Harper Jr. on Tuesday after he led officers on a 20-mile high-speed chase on Interstate 95. The chase ended when Harper crashed the stolen vehicle.
Police Chief Mike Chitwood says Harper has confessed to killing 34-year-old Ronald Brown.
The police chief says Harper told him Brown had offered a ride early Sunday morning as he walked in downtown Columbia, South Carolina. Harper says Brown asked him for gas money and pulled out a gun after he got into his vehicle.
Harper told the police he pulled out his own gun and shot Brown.
Brown was an instructor at Benedict College.
